How To Say “And” In Spanish

Introduction

“And” is a fundamental conjunction used to connect words, phrases, and clauses in a sentence, and it plays a crucial role in forming coherent sentences. In Spanish, the word for “and” is “y.” Mastering how to use “y” correctly will help you express yourself more fluently and effectively in Spanish. In this article, we’ll explore the various ways to use “y” in Spanish and provide you with examples to improve your understanding.

Basic Translation

The most common translation for “and” in Spanish is “y.” It’s a simple and straightforward conjunction that works similarly to its English counterpart.

Example:

“I like coffee and tea” translates to “Me gusta el café y el té.”

Using “Y” in Different Contexts

The conjunction “y” is used in various situations, just like “and” in English. Here are some common ways to use it:

1. Connecting Words:

“Y” is used to connect two or more words that belong together in a sentence.

Example:
– “Bread and butter” translates to “Pan y mantequilla.”

2. Joining Phrases:

You can use “y” to link two independent phrases or ideas in a sentence.

Example:
– “I like to read, and she likes to paint” translates to “Me gusta leer, y a ella le gusta pintar.”

3. Combining Verbs:

“Y” is used when combining multiple verbs in a sentence.

Example:
– “I eat, drink, and sleep” translates to “Como, bebo y duermo.”

4. In Lists:

“Y” is used to separate items in a list.

Example:
– “The colors of the flag are red, yellow, and blue” translates to “Los colores de la bandera son rojo, amarillo y azul.”
